Akawaio

Verb

aituma[1]

  1. (transitive) to make something or someone go fast.
    Mɨrɨpan ipan pe nin si, Sir Benson uya insin aitumaꞌpʉ mɨrɨ.When (he realized) I was so sick, Sir Benson sped up the engine

Estonian

Alternative forms

Etymology

A reduction of aita (help) jumal (god).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ɑi̯ˈtumɑ/, [ɑi̯ˈtumɑ]
  • Rhymes: -umɑ
  • Hyphenation: ai‧tu‧ma

Interjection

aituma

  1. thank you, thanks
